A way to uninstall 1Password from your PC

This web page contains complete information on how to uninstall 1Password for Windows. It is produced by AgileBits Inc.. More info about AgileBits Inc. can be found here. Further information about 1Password can be seen at . Usually the 1Password program is to be found in the C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\1password\app\7 folder, depending on the user's option during setup. You can remove 1Password by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\1password\app\7\unins000.exe. Keep in mind that you might get a notification for admin rights. The program's main executable file is titled 1Password.exe and it has a size of 7.76 MB (8134544 bytes).

1Password install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 13.15 MB (13791920 bytes) on disk.

  • 1Password.brain.exe (3.82 MB)
  • 1Password.exe (7.76 MB)
  • unins000.exe (1.58 MB)
